Moses Thomas, Freestone County, Texas, 1867
Moses Thomas registered to vote in Freestone County on August 17, 1867. He reported Georgia as his birthplace. The registrar wrote "Colored" beside his name. Freestone County registered 960 freedmen in 1867, 54% of its voters.

Sources
This entry comes from the 1867 to 1870 Texas voter registration, the Texas Secretary of State registration lists held by the Texas State Library and Archives Commission. It sits on page 27 of the Freestone County volume, written out by hand. About Enslaved Texas.
